What is the Mullet Fade?
The mullet fade is a modern hairstyle that combines the classic mullet with a fade cut. The front and sides are kept short, while the back features longer hair, creating a striking contrast. The fade adds a contemporary edge, blending seamlessly into the shorter sections. This hairstyle is often favored for its versatility, allowing individuals to style it in various ways, from sleek and polished to messy and textured.
How Did the Mullet Fade Come to Be?
The mullet fade has its roots in the 80s, a decade famous for bold fashion choices and unique hairstyles. Originally, the mullet was seen as a symbol of rebellion, often associated with rock musicians and cultural icons. As time went on, the hairstyle faded into the background, only to be revived with modern twists like the fade, which offers a fresh take on a classic look.

How to Achieve the Perfect Mullet Fade?
Getting a mullet fade requires skilled hands and a clear vision. Here are the steps to achieve the perfect look:
- Consult with your hairstylist to discuss desired length and fade style.
- Start by cutting the front and sides to your preferred length.
- Gradually blend the hair into the back, creating a smooth transition.
- Style the back to your liking, whether straight, wavy, or textured.

Who Should Avoid the Mullet Fade?
While the mullet fade is a fantastic choice for many, it may not suit everyone. Individuals with very fine hair may find it challenging to achieve the desired volume and texture. Additionally, those with specific professional environments that favor conservative hairstyles may want to consider their options before committing to this bold look.
